> on that cos if you remmeber it was the 70s Queen never used keyboreds bak in those days
False:
Loads of songs from 1972 to 1979 had piano. Piano IS a keyboard.
Liar and Now I'm Here (1971-2 and 1973) had organ. Organ IS a keyboard.
Fairy Feller's Master Stroke (1973) had harpsichord. Harpsichord IS a keyboard.
Killer Queen, Leroy Brown and Rendezvous (1974 & 1975) had jangle piano. Jangle piano IS a keyboard.
Best Friend (1975) had e-piano. E-piano IS a keyboard.
Teo Torraitte (1976) had harmonium and e-piano. Harmonium and e-piano ARE keyboards.
Save Me and Sail Away Sweet Sister (1979) had synthesiser. Synthesiser IS a keyboard.
